With the exception of Godzilla vs Gigan, all the showa Godzilla films have opening credit music that plays a full piece and is allowed to gracefully fade out. However, during the opening of King Kong vs Godzilla, the opening music (the Farou Island chant) abruptly fades out mid-way through the second verse. However, on both the soundtrack CD and on the edited festival version of the film (which shoehorns monster footage into the credits sequence) the music is allowed to play through two full verses before it fades out.
It seems weird that the original Japanese version of King Kong vs Godzilla would not include the full opening music track, which is pretty much a standard on all showa Godzilla movies.
